The socio-psychological influence of society on adolescents' attitudes towards money
Kholmuratova Mahbuba Makhmudovna

The article examines the socio-psychological influence of society on adolescents’ attitudes toward money. The main social factors that shape the economic perceptions of adolescents, including the family environment, the education system and the environment are analyzed. Additionally, their personal attitudes toward money and the social and cultural processes in
society affecting these attitudes are explored

The potential of cognitive behavioral therapy techniques in working with victims of domestic violence
Ismaylova Ra’no

The article is dedicated to studying the problem of anxiety among individuals affected by domestic violence. Nowadays, the increasing occurrence of domestic violence in society, particularly violence in marital relationships, is considered one of the most widespread psychological factors that lead to a decrease in the overall quality of life and the development of various mental and nervous disorders due to the high levels of anxiety. In modern psychological practice, cognitive-behavioral therapy is considered one of the most effective approaches, and the author demonstrates the effectiveness of these therapy techniques when working with individuals affected by domestic violence

The impact of gender aspects in the speech of husbands and wives on family relationships
Nomozova Ugiloy Akmaljon kizi

Communication is considered the most crucial and essential process in all aspects of human life and can significantly impact every activity. Similarly, speech etiquette and communication processes within the family are factors that have a substantial influence on family relationships. There are gender-specific characteristics and features of communication, which are
also clearly reflected in family interactions. This article highlights the characteristics of gender aspects in the speech of husbands and wives within the family and their influence on relationships among family members and family well-being. To support the topic, the views of Uzbek and foreign scholars on this matter have been analyzed

Evolving views on autism spectrum disorder: changing international diagnostic criteria and public attitudes
Musaeva Mekhribon Ikrom kizi

The article describes the historical development of the doctrine of autism. The main periods of formation of scientific understanding of this disorder in the development of children are described in detail. A comprehensive analysis of the achievements of science and practice in the study of autism is considered.

Analysis and recommendations aimed at developing the educational function of the family based on international evaluation studies
Matkarimov Akramdjon Mukhtorovich

The success of students in education depends on such factors as the educational process, educational programs, methods, and educational literature in comprehensive schools. It is also said that students’ success in education depends on sociopedagogical
factors such as the economic and social status of the family, the educational environment in the family, and the attitude of parents towards education. The article presents an analysis of scientific research on these socio-pedagogical factors.
